About Databricks
Databricks is the data and AI company. More than 10,000 organizations worldwide — including Comcast, Condé Nast, Grammarly, and over 50% of the Fortune 500 — rely on the Databricks Data Intelligence Platform to unify and democratize data, analytics and AI. Databricks is headquartered in San Francisco, with offices around the globe and was founded by the original creators of Lakehouse, Apache Spark™, Delta Lake and MLflow. What is Candlelight?
Since July 2019, Fever Originals has produced a series of classical music concerts in a “candlelight setting” which take place in the most intimate and undiscovered venues all over the world. Cities include: France (Paris, Toulouse, Lyon), Spain (Madrid, Barcelona, Seville, Valencia), Portugal (Lisbon and Porto), and the United States (Los Angeles, New York, and Chicago), and are in the process of expanding to your city! Candlelight has democratized classical music by sharing it with the general public and providing a unique experience for each of our audiences. As of today, Candlelight concerts are present in over 300 cities around the world!
